One can find numerous candidates for the designation as “planet’s most significant invention.” The wheel. The printing press. The combustion motor.
According to a recent publication, though, that honor should go to a automated sawmill invented by Dutchman Corneliszoon van Uitgeest during 1593.
“Prior to mechanised sawing, constructing a modest merchant vessel required approximately 10 lumberjacks laboring for three months,” writes Jaime Dávila. “Using wind-driven lumber mills, the same quantity of cut lumber might be manufactured within a week.”
Owing to this speedy mechanical saw, that turned timber into boards using virtually no manual labor, Dutch builders were able to construct vessels more quickly compared to anyone else, an advantage that unleashed a century of Netherlands maritime, economic as well as artistic dominance across the continent and the world.
The Original True Manufacturing Machine
The inventor's lumber mill, argues Dávila, represented “mankind’s first true factory machine.” A windmill rotated a wheel. A single part converted its circular motion into vertical motion to power the cutting blade. Another component changed the rotary movement into a sideway’s motion advancing the log to the blade. A ratchet system moved the log ahead one precise increment per cycle.
“Every component was modest on its own. Corneliszoon’s brilliance was to integrate them in order that the machine acted in a precisely synchronized sequence, cutting with each descending motion and advancing with each upward motion. It was an astonishingly intelligent application of fundamental components.”
